MIDDLE EASTERN LEMONADE
Steps:
- Muddle the sugar and mint in the bottom of a pitcher. Stir in the lemon juice, 4 cups cold water and the orange flower water until the sugar is dissolved. Add the orange slices, cover and refrigerate until very cold, about 2 hours. Serve over ice.
- For a cocktail version, add a shot of lemon vodka to each glass.
HOMEMADE LEMONADE
No summertime drink is as satisfying and easy to make as refreshing lemonade.

Steps:
- In a small saucepan, combine sugar and 2 1/2 cups water.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, stirring until sugar is dissolved. Remove from heat; let cool.
- In a punch bowl or large container, combine the lemon juice, sugar syrup, remaining 4 cups water, and ice. Stir well to combine. Thinly slice remaining lemon, and add to lemonade. Serve.
MIDDLE EASTERN LIMONANA
This Middle Wastern limonana recipe is a bright-green combination of lemon and mint inspired by the drinks found on tables throughout the Middle East.

Steps:
- In a blender, combine the lemon juice, mint, sugar, and 1/2 cup of the water and blend until fully liquid. Strain through a fine-mesh sieve, reserving the liquid and discarding the solids. In a pitcher, stir together the mint mixture and the remaining 3 1/2 cups water. Serve over ice cubes.
